what is 710 friendly
“710 friendly” usually means a place, person, or product is welcoming to cannabis concentrates like oils, dabs, vape oils, or edibles, rather than just flower. The term comes from flipping “710” upside down, which reads like “OIL”.
What it implies
- It often signals comfort with concentrate use in cannabis culture.
- It can be used in listings, events, or shops to show they cater to dabbers and oil users.
- It is related to “420 friendly,” but more specific to concentrates and oils.
Simple example
If someone says a lounge or rental is “710 friendly,” they usually mean it’s open to cannabis concentrate users, not necessarily all cannabis use.
Context
The phrase has become more common in cannabis forums and business marketing, especially around “710” or “Oil Day” on July 10.
